Tax Property or Property Transfers?

RE/MAX Condo Plus makes a good point about Toronto’s maligned land transfer tax proposal.  Toronto’s property taxes are the lowest in the GTA.  In fact, they’re below the value of services Toronto residents receive. 

City hall could have just increased property taxes to the GTA average.  Instead, the Mayor has chosen to hammer people with a lump-sum tax when they move. 

The logic was to protect homeowners, particularly seniors, from increased annual tax liabilities.  In fact, it all comes out in the wash either way, but the latter strategy makes for worse headlines.
